A system designed to convert Japanese script from its cursive, phonetic form into its angular, primarily phonetic form allows users to transcribe words and phrases between these two writing systems. For example, inputting the hiragana characters “” (konnichiwa) would result in the katakana output “.”
Such a conversion tool facilitates language learning, particularly for those familiarizing themselves with katakana’s common usage in representing loanwords and onomatopoeia. It also aids in interpreting texts where stylistic choices or specific contexts necessitate the use of katakana instead of the more frequently encountered hiragana. Historically, these tools have evolved from simple character mapping tables to sophisticated algorithms capable of handling nuanced linguistic transformations.
Understanding the functionalities and applications of this conversion process is beneficial for those studying the Japanese language. Subsequent sections will delve into specific use cases, available tools, and potential challenges associated with character conversion.
1. Conversion Accuracy
Conversion accuracy is paramount in any system that transcribes between hiragana and katakana. The reliability of the output directly impacts the usefulness of such tools in various applications, from language education to document processing.
-
Correct Character Mapping
Fundamental to conversion accuracy is the correct mapping of each hiragana character to its corresponding katakana equivalent. Mismaps result in nonsensical or misleading outputs. For instance, incorrectly converting “” (a) to “” (ro) instead of “” (a) constitutes a significant error. Accurate mapping relies on a comprehensive understanding of the Unicode standard and its implementation for both scripts.
-
Handling of Diacritics and Small Characters
Both hiragana and katakana utilize diacritics (dakuten and handakuten) and small versions of characters to modify pronunciation. A conversion system must accurately represent these modifications. Failure to properly convert “” (pa) to “” (pa), for example, alters the intended sound and meaning. The algorithm must identify and replicate these nuanced character variations.
-
Contextual Ambiguity Resolution
While relatively infrequent, certain hiragana combinations might lend themselves to multiple katakana interpretations depending on context, particularly when dealing with archaic or stylistic usages. A higher accuracy system might incorporate basic natural language processing to disambiguate these instances, though most prioritize direct character correspondence.
-
Error Rate Measurement and Improvement
Conversion accuracy is often quantified as an error rate, calculated as the percentage of incorrectly converted characters within a given text. Developers continuously refine their algorithms by testing them against large corpora of Japanese text and addressing identified shortcomings. Lower error rates indicate superior performance.
In conclusion, conversion accuracy directly determines the utility of any tool designed to translate between hiragana and katakana. A system with high accuracy ensures reliable transcription, supporting language learners, translators, and other professionals who rely on accurate representation of Japanese text. Continual improvement in mapping, diacritic handling, and contextual awareness is essential for optimizing performance.
2. Ease of Use
The practical value of a hiragana to katakana translator is significantly influenced by its ease of use. A complex or unintuitive interface can hinder its effectiveness, regardless of its accuracy or speed. Usability directly impacts the accessibility of the tool, determining how efficiently users can perform the required script conversion. For instance, a translator requiring multiple steps or specialized knowledge before conversion can be initiated presents a barrier, particularly for novice learners. Conversely, a streamlined interface featuring simple input and output fields enhances user experience. The accessibility of the translated text for copying or exporting is another critical factor.
Further considerations include mobile compatibility and the presence of supplementary functions. A translator accessible across multiple devices provides greater flexibility. The inclusion of features such as automatic text sizing or the ability to adjust the output based on preferred writing conventions can also improve usability. For example, a user translating text on a smartphone benefits from a mobile-optimized interface. A desktop application, while potentially offering more advanced functionality, must still maintain ease of use to remain effective. The availability of keyboard shortcuts and clear instructions also facilitates the user experience.
In summary, ease of use is an essential attribute of a hiragana to katakana translator. Intuitiveness reduces the learning curve, allowing users to focus on the task of script conversion rather than navigating a complicated interface. This element enhances the tool’s practical application in language education, document processing, and other relevant fields. A balance between functionality and usability is therefore crucial for maximizing the value of such a translator.
3. Speed of Translation
The efficiency with which a hiragana to katakana translator completes its task directly impacts its utility, particularly in contexts requiring real-time or high-volume script conversion. The speed of translation, therefore, represents a critical performance metric.
-
Algorithm Efficiency
The underlying algorithm used by the translator significantly influences processing speed. Algorithms relying on simple character mapping tables are generally faster than those incorporating contextual analysis or more complex linguistic rules. However, this speed advantage may come at the cost of accuracy in specific cases. The algorithm’s optimization for computational efficiency is paramount.
-
Hardware and Software Infrastructure
The speed is also dependent on the hardware and software infrastructure. A translator hosted on a high-performance server will generally outperform one operating on less powerful systems. Similarly, software design, including memory management and parallel processing capabilities, plays a crucial role in determining throughput. Online tools are subject to network latency.
-
Input Size and Complexity
The volume of text to be translated inherently affects the duration of the process. Larger inputs naturally require more processing time. Additionally, the complexity of the text, including the presence of uncommon characters or intricate grammatical structures, can influence the translation speed, particularly for systems employing advanced analytical methods.
-
Parallel Processing Implementation
The use of parallel processing can significantly accelerate the conversion of hiragana to katakana, particularly for large amounts of text. By dividing the text into smaller segments and processing them simultaneously, parallel processing leverages multiple processing units to reduce overall processing time. The effectiveness of this approach depends on the algorithm’s design and the underlying hardware architecture.
In summary, the speed of translation for a hiragana to katakana translator is a multifaceted attribute influenced by algorithmic efficiency, infrastructure, input characteristics, and parallel processing capabilities. High-speed translation is particularly valuable in applications where quick turnaround times are essential, such as in live language interpretation or rapid document conversion. A trade-off between speed and accuracy must often be considered when selecting or developing such a tool.
4. Character Support
Character support directly dictates the comprehensiveness and reliability of a hiragana to katakana translator. The range of characters accurately processed by the translator determines its utility across diverse texts, from contemporary literature to historical documents. Inadequate character support leads to incomplete or erroneous transcriptions, diminishing the tool’s practical value. For example, a translator lacking support for archaic hiragana characters would fail to accurately convert older texts, rendering it unsuitable for historical research purposes. The ability to correctly handle variations in character form, such as those found in different fonts, is also crucial for maintaining fidelity to the original text. Consequently, robust character support is a fundamental requirement for any effective hiragana to katakana translation system.
The implementation of character support involves adherence to established encoding standards, primarily Unicode. Full Unicode compliance ensures that the translator can represent virtually all hiragana and katakana characters, including those rarely encountered. Furthermore, the system must accurately handle diacritics and small kana (such as “” or “”) which modify pronunciation. In practical applications, a translator with comprehensive character support is essential for converting names, addresses, and specialized terminology, as these often contain characters not found in basic character sets. A business expanding into the Japanese market, for instance, requires accurate transcription of product names and marketing materials. Insufficient character support could lead to misrepresentations and potential brand damage.
In conclusion, character support is not merely an ancillary feature but an integral component of any functional hiragana to katakana translator. Its absence severely limits the scope of translatable materials and compromises the accuracy of the output. While processing speed and ease of use are also important considerations, the underlying ability to handle a wide array of characters remains the bedrock of a reliable translation tool. The ongoing evolution of Unicode and the emergence of new character variations necessitate continuous updates and improvements to character support, ensuring that translators remain current and effective.
5. Contextual Sensitivity
The degree to which a hiragana to katakana translator exhibits contextual sensitivity directly impacts the quality and appropriateness of its output. While the primary function is character-by-character conversion, the absence of contextual awareness can lead to transcriptions that are technically accurate but stylistically or functionally unsuitable. The significance arises from the differing roles of hiragana and katakana within the Japanese writing system. Hiragana serves as the fundamental phonetic script for native words, grammatical particles, and verb endings. Katakana, conversely, is primarily used for loanwords, onomatopoeia, emphasis, and foreign names. A translator lacking contextual understanding might convert hiragana used for emphasis into katakana, resulting in a stylistically jarring and potentially confusing output.
Contextual sensitivity could encompass the ability to recognize when hiragana is being used stylistically to represent words typically written in kanji. In such cases, simply converting to katakana would lose the original intent. Ideally, a sophisticated translator would identify these instances and potentially flag them for human review. In practice, achieving full contextual sensitivity is a complex natural language processing challenge. However, even basic rules-based systems can improve output by recognizing common patterns and exceptions. For instance, a rule preventing the conversion of grammatical particles from hiragana to katakana would prevent stylistic errors. Similarly, recognizing proper nouns written in hiragana due to stylistic preferences could also improve the quality of the conversion.
In conclusion, the practical usefulness of a hiragana to katakana translator is significantly enhanced by its ability to interpret and respond to context. While perfect contextual awareness remains a challenge, even incremental improvements in this area lead to more natural, readable, and functionally appropriate translations. The development of more sophisticated translators necessitates the integration of increasingly advanced natural language processing techniques to address this crucial aspect of script conversion.
6. Platform Availability
The utility of any hiragana to katakana translator is directly proportional to its accessibility across various platforms. Limited platform availability restricts access, thereby diminishing its overall effectiveness. A translator confined to a single operating system or device type inherently serves a smaller user base compared to one accessible on multiple platforms. The increased demand for mobile access necessitates translators functional on smartphones and tablets, alongside traditional desktop environments. The absence of cross-platform functionality reduces the potential user base and limits the convenience for individuals needing script conversion on different devices throughout their day. For example, a student studying Japanese might use a desktop translator at home but require a mobile version while commuting.
Diverse deployment options enhance a translator’s adaptability and integration into varied workflows. Web-based translators, accessible via any device with a web browser, offer immediate usability without requiring software installation. Dedicated desktop applications might provide enhanced features or offline functionality. Browser extensions can streamline conversion directly within web pages. Application Programming Interfaces (APIs) permit integration into larger software systems or automated workflows. The selection of platforms and deployment methods depends on target user needs and development resources. An educational institution might prioritize web-based access for its students, while a software development firm might opt for an API to integrate conversion capabilities into its translation tools.
In summary, platform availability is a critical determinant of a hiragana to katakana translator’s practical value. Broad availability maximizes accessibility, while diverse deployment options facilitate integration into varied user workflows. A comprehensive approach to platform support ensures that the translator can meet the diverse needs of language learners, translators, and other professionals who require reliable script conversion. Overcoming challenges related to platform-specific development complexities is essential for achieving widespread usability.
7. Encoding Compatibility
Encoding compatibility is a foundational requirement for any functional system designed to convert between hiragana and katakana. The ability to accurately represent Japanese characters, irrespective of the platform or software environment, hinges on adherence to standardized encoding schemes.
-
Unicode Standard Adherence
The Unicode standard serves as the bedrock for character encoding in modern computing. A hiragana to katakana translator must fully support the Unicode range allocated to both scripts to accurately process all valid characters. Failure to adhere to Unicode results in mojibake, where characters are misinterpreted or displayed incorrectly. For instance, if a translator relies on an older encoding like Shift-JIS, it will likely fail to convert newer or less common characters accurately.
-
UTF-8 Encoding Dominance
UTF-8, a variable-width character encoding capable of representing all Unicode characters, has become the dominant encoding scheme for web-based applications and data transmission. A web-based translator must utilize UTF-8 for both input and output to ensure cross-browser and cross-platform compatibility. Incorrect handling of UTF-8 encoding can lead to character corruption or display errors, particularly when dealing with text containing a mixture of Japanese and other languages.
-
Character Normalization Forms
Unicode defines several normalization forms to address the issue of equivalent character sequences. A translator should ideally normalize input to a consistent form (e.g., NFC or NFKC) to ensure that semantically identical characters are treated as such during conversion. For example, a character composed of a base character and a combining diacritic might be represented in multiple ways. Normalization ensures consistent handling of such variations.
-
Font Support Dependency
While encoding defines how characters are represented, the actual visual display depends on the availability of appropriate fonts. A translator might accurately convert characters internally but fail to display them correctly if the user’s system lacks the necessary font support for Japanese. This is particularly relevant for less common or specialized characters. The translator may need to suggest appropriate font installations to ensure correct rendering.
Encoding compatibility is thus inextricably linked to the reliable operation of a hiragana to katakana translator. Consistent application of Unicode standards, especially UTF-8, coupled with an awareness of character normalization and font dependencies, ensures that script conversion is accurate and universally accessible.
Frequently Asked Questions
The following addresses common inquiries regarding the function, application, and limitations of systems designed to convert between hiragana and katakana scripts.
Question 1: What is the fundamental purpose of a hiragana to katakana translator?
The primary function is the conversion of Japanese text from hiragana, a cursive phonetic script, to katakana, an angular phonetic script often used for loanwords, emphasis, and onomatopoeia. It provides a mechanical transcription service.
Question 2: How accurate are automated hiragana to katakana translators?
Accuracy varies significantly based on the sophistication of the system. While most can accurately convert individual characters, contextual nuances may be overlooked, leading to stylistically inappropriate output in some instances.
Question 3: Can a hiragana to katakana translator be used to learn Japanese?
While not a substitute for comprehensive language study, it can serve as a supplementary tool for understanding the relationship between the two scripts, especially for recognizing katakana equivalents of common words and phrases.
Question 4: What are the limitations of relying solely on a hiragana to katakana translator?
These tools typically lack the ability to interpret the intended meaning or stylistic intent of the original text. They are generally unsuitable for tasks requiring nuanced understanding or creative adaptation of the source material.
Question 5: Are there specific contexts in which a hiragana to katakana translator is particularly useful?
Conversion can be helpful for quickly rendering Japanese text in a format suitable for specific applications, such as creating visual aids, generating onomatopoeic sound effects, or transcribing foreign names. Note that human review is often advisable.
Question 6: What factors should be considered when selecting a hiragana to katakana translator?
Critical factors include conversion accuracy, ease of use, platform availability, character support (including archaic forms), and handling of encoding (e.g., Unicode/UTF-8). The specific needs of the task should dictate the relative importance of these factors.
In summary, these translation tools provide a mechanical conversion service between two Japanese writing systems. Consider the accuracy limitations and the importance of human review for tasks that need stylistic nuance.
The subsequent section will explore specific translation software and tools.
Hiragana to Katakana Translator
Effective utilization of a system designed for converting between hiragana and katakana necessitates an understanding of its functionalities and limitations. These tips aim to maximize the benefits derived from such tools while mitigating potential errors.
Tip 1: Prioritize Accurate Input. The quality of the output is directly dependent on the accuracy of the input. Ensure the hiragana text is correctly transcribed before initiating the conversion process. Verify proper use of small kana and diacritics.
Tip 2: Understand Contextual Limitations. Conversion systems primarily perform character-by-character translations and often lack contextual awareness. When stylistic nuance or semantic understanding is crucial, human review is essential.
Tip 3: Utilize Conversion for Appropriate Purposes. These tools are most effective for transcribing loanwords, onomatopoeia, and emphasis. Avoid relying on them for translating entire sentences or paragraphs where grammatical structure is paramount.
Tip 4: Confirm Character Encoding. Ensure that both the input and output utilize Unicode UTF-8 encoding to prevent character corruption or display errors. Verify that the target system supports Japanese fonts.
Tip 5: Explore Advanced Features (If Available). Some systems offer features such as customizable conversion rules or batch processing capabilities. Explore these options to streamline workflow and improve output quality.
Tip 6: Cross-Validate Results. Where feasible, cross-validate the output with a secondary source, such as a Japanese dictionary or a native speaker, to identify and correct any inaccuracies.
Tip 7: Understand the Purpose of Katakana. Katakana generally represents foreign words, so always confirm the source of the word. Using Katakana for a native Japanese word will look unnatural.
These tips emphasize the importance of accurate input, contextual awareness, and encoding standards when employing a hiragana to katakana translator. Proper utilization enhances the tool’s effectiveness and minimizes potential errors.
Subsequent sections will detail specific scenarios where employing these script conversion tools can be advantageous.
Conclusion
This article has explored the multifaceted aspects of the hiragana to katakana translator, from its basic functionality and underlying mechanisms to its practical applications and inherent limitations. Crucial elements, including conversion accuracy, ease of use, translation speed, character support, and encoding compatibility, have been examined. The impact of contextual sensitivity and platform availability on overall utility was also discussed.
The effectiveness of a hiragana to katakana translator ultimately depends on a balanced consideration of these factors. As technology evolves, continued refinement of conversion algorithms and expansion of character support will be essential for meeting the growing demands of language learners, translators, and professionals engaged in Japanese language processing. Future efforts should focus on enhancing contextual awareness to ensure that script conversion is not only accurate but also stylistically appropriate. Such advancements will be critical for maximizing the benefits derived from this invaluable tool.